We have an exciting new opportunity for a dynamic and experienced Landscape Designer. In this pivotal role, you will nurture client relationships and create designs that bring customers' dreams to life. The ideal candidate will also have a desire to live out our values of: Excellence, Positivity, Integrity, and Collaboration.THE ROLE
- RELATIONSHIP MANAGEMENT: Maintain and cultivate current customer relationships and referral sources. Communicate regularly with clients on project updates, alterations, and designs. Actively represent the company in the community. Ensure client satisfaction upon project completion and review final project statements.
- ACHIEVE SALES PERFORMANCE GOALS: Track sales targets and milestones. Utilize strong sales skills to showcase company capabilities and competitive advantages. Prepare detailed, competitive estimates that align with company gross margin goals and meet client budget requirements.
- PROJECT MANAGEMENT: Take accurate measurements and elevations of client properties. Ensure accurate, to-scale designs that bring client ideas to life and guide production teams. Produce detailed job packets with all necessary information for seamless installations. Coordinate with Operations and the customer before, during, and after the project. Maintain records in the company's sales tracking system and provide regular updates.
- KNOWLEDGE: Bachelor's degree in Business Management, Marketing, Horticulture, Construction, or a related field; or equivalent experience. Consistent work history with a minimum of 2 years in landscape design, in roles such as Landscape Sales Designer, Landscape Sales Consultant, or similar role in the landscaping, construction, or service industry.
- SKILLS: Proven sales ability with consistent results and productivity. Excellent verbal and written communication skills for engaging with clients, employees, and stakeholders. Familiarity with landscaping design software and project management tools. Strong analytical, problem-solving skills, and attention to detail. Ability to adapt to a dynamic environment and thrive under pressure through a commitment to excellence.
- ABILITY: This role is onsite and requires reporting to our office in Waterloo, NE. A valid driver's license and ability to pass a felony/misdemeanor background and driving (Motor Vehicle Record) check.
We are a growing and ambitious company that works to care for our employees with an ambitious benefits program: $50k employer-paid life insurance, retirement plan with match up to 3%, health insurance, paid holidays, 2 weeks (80 hours) paid time off (after 6 months), and a paid week off between Christmas and New Years.
